Abdulrahman is a Principal Fire Engineer with expertise in fire and structural fire engineering of tunnels and buildings, coupled with research interests in structural performance and fire behavior of timber, FRP, and concrete. He is also experienced in FLS master planning for ordinary new developments and for aviation master planning. During his tenure as a PhD research candidate at the University of Queensland, he concentrated on proposing engineering solutions to enhance the structural behavior of timber floor systems under fire exposure.
